Description
The Mill House is well located on the edge of this sought after village with lovely westerly views over the surrounding countryside. The house is slightly elevated, above the river Glyme and adjoining former Water Mill, and is where the miller would have lived. The house is Grade II listed and dates from 1789.
The layout can be seen from the floor plan; suffice to say the 'flow' has been greatly improved by the current owners with a double height extension providing a great sense of arrival. There is good sized family accommodation over three floors with cellar in addition.

There is off-street parking from the lane. The garden is in two parts, to the front and rear, with the front deliberately left as a natural and wild Cottage garden.
There is a detached original Smithy, which has potential as home office/annexe, subject to the necessary consents.

This attractive and sought-after Oxfordshire hamlet is situated in the Glyme Valley. The nearby villages of Enstone and Church Enstone have a shop, public houses, petrol station and a Church. Woodstock and Chipping Norton provide a wider range of amenities. Charlbury, Oxford and Banbury are also within easy reach.
Charlbury Station is a mainline link into London Paddington via Oxford. Other excellent rail links can be found from Bicester, Banbury and Oxford Parkway to London Marylebone. The M40 provides a good link to both the North and the South.
Soho Farmhouse in Great Tew and the highly regarded Daylesford Organic Farm Shop located near Kingham are nearby.
Access to schooling is excellent and the village is within reach of Oxford schools. There are primary schools in Enstone and Great Tew.
